**KEY TASKS AND ACCOUNTABILITIES**:

- To build relationships with our customers and solve problems with our products and services
- Meet individual/exceed targets and assist in meeting targets set for team and business unit
- Outbound call on leads provided from agents and other areas of the business
- Approach each day as a fresh challenge and with an enthusiasm to deliver
- Work using script/call guide
- To take ownership and responsibility of your workload and performance
- To take ownership of keeping up to date with the newest offers available for our customers and the savings that can be made as a HomeLet/Let Alliance customer
- To achieve or exceed target on all quality assessments
- Work closely with all departments to deliver exceptional service
- To give feedback to our Customer Development Team
- Input accurate data into all necessary logs, trackers, and databases to accurately record information and provide adequate MI and audit trails
- To report to Team Leader any problems encountered or to a supervisor in absence of a Team Leader
- To identify and make recommendations for improvements to current working practices as required
- Prepare for monthly performance reviews, annual performance, and development appraisals
- Attend and participate at your team meeting
- To carry out any other tasks as directed by Team Leaders or Manager
